Поделиться через


IRelationalCommandDiagnosticsLogger.DataReaderDisposing Метод

Определение

Журналы для DataReaderDisposing события.

public Microsoft.EntityFrameworkCore.Diagnostics.InterceptionResult DataReaderDisposing (Microsoft.EntityFrameworkCore.Storage.IRelationalConnection connection, System.Data.Common.DbCommand command, System.Data.Common.DbDataReader dataReader, Guid commandId, int recordsAffected, int readCount, DateTimeOffset startTime, TimeSpan duration);
abstract member DataReaderDisposing : Microsoft.EntityFrameworkCore.Storage.IRelationalConnection * System.Data.Common.DbCommand * System.Data.Common.DbDataReader * Guid * int * int * DateTimeOffset * TimeSpan -> Microsoft.EntityFrameworkCore.Diagnostics.InterceptionResult
Public Function DataReaderDisposing (connection As IRelationalConnection, command As DbCommand, dataReader As DbDataReader, commandId As Guid, recordsAffected As Integer, readCount As Integer, startTime As DateTimeOffset, duration As TimeSpan) As InterceptionResult

Параметры

connection
IRelationalConnection

Соединение.

command
DbCommand

Объект команды базы данных.

dataReader
DbDataReader

Модуль чтения данных.

commandId
Guid

Идентификатор корреляции, связанный с данным DbCommandобъектом .

recordsAffected
Int32

Количество затронутых записей в базе данных.

readCount
Int32

Количество прочитанных записей.

startTime
DateTimeOffset

Время начала операции.

duration
TimeSpan

Время, затраченное с момента начала операции.

Возвращаемое значение

Результат выполнения, который мог быть изменен перехватчиком.

Применяется к